Domed Stadiums

Smarting under allegations that it is colder in Canada than in the U.S. and that Canadian cities would not be able to get and keep major sports franchises without an indoor stadium, planning geniuses across the country have built three domed stadiums without gaining a single sports franchise. On the positive side, the Domes give Canadians at least three locations where they can attend monster tractor pulls in the middle of winter, and offer suitably unhealthy but year-round environments for outdoor evangelical revivals, religious conventions, and airborne fungi of a wide and toxic variety
